SR-IOV技术在OpenStack云平台上的应用

SR-IOV技术在OpenStack云平台上的应用

ID:37028417

大小:2.47 MB

页数:59页

时间:2019-05-15

SR-IOV技术在OpenStack云平台上的应用_第1页
SR-IOV技术在OpenStack云平台上的应用_第2页
SR-IOV技术在OpenStack云平台上的应用_第3页
SR-IOV技术在OpenStack云平台上的应用_第4页
SR-IOV技术在OpenStack云平台上的应用_第5页
资源描述:

《SR-IOV技术在OpenStack云平台上的应用》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、武汉邮电科学研究院硕士学位论文SR-IOV技术在OpenStack云平台上的应用A-onlicationofSRIOVTechnoloppgyOpenStackCloudPlatform专业:通信与信息系统研究方向:互联网技术导师:张傲研究生:张驰学号:20140061二〇一^年三月武汉邮电科学研究院硕士学位论文独创性声明本人声明所呈交的论文是我个人在导师指导下进行的研究工作及取得的研究成果,除了文中特别加以标注的地方外,没有任何剽窃、抄袭、造假等违反学术道

2、德、学术规范的行为一,也没有侵犯任何其他人或组织的科研成果及专利。与我同工作的同志对本研宄所做的任何贡献均已在论文中作了明确的说明并表示了谢意。如有任何侵权行为,本人愿意为此独立承担全部责任。i作者签名:^H签字曰期:?关于论文使用授权的说明本人完全了解武汉邮电科学研究院(烽火科技集团)有关保留、使用学位论文的规定,本文知识产权归武汉邮电科学研究院所有,武汉邮电科学研究院有权保留送交论文的复印件和电子版本,允许论文被查阅和借阅。同意将本人的学位论文提交中国学术期刊(光盘版)电子杂志社

3、全文出版并收入《中国学位论文全文数据库》。□公开□保密一年□保密两年注:保密的学位论文在解密后遵守此协议()、作者签名:签字曰期:办f?;今导师签名:签字曰期:武汉邮电科学研究院硕士学位论文摘要随着云时代的来临,各种各样的云计算平台应运而生,例如亚马逊公司的AWS云平台以及微软公司的Azure云平台等。而围绕着开源的优势,OpenStack云平台在近几年得到了越来越多的个人开发者和各大企业的支持,成为当今最火的云平台之一。OpenStack云平台的目的在于简化云平台的部署过程,其组件之间交互式的架

4、构使得OpenStack云平台具有非常好的扩展性。与此同时,CPU虚拟化与内存虚拟化技术已日趋成熟,性能也已经达到了预期,但是I/O虚拟化技术却发展落后,远远没有达到业界要求。I/O虚拟化技术的不成熟极大地影响了虚拟机的整体性能,因此当前虚拟化技术的研究重点之一便是改进I/O虚拟化技术以提高物理I/O设备的虚拟化性能。SR-IOV(Single-RootI/OVirtualization,单根I/O虚拟化)技术是一种基于物理硬件的虚拟化解决方案,可以提高物理I/O设备的性能与可扩展性。SR-IOV技术允许在虚拟机之间高效

5、共享PCIe(PeripheralComponentInterconnectExpress,快速外设组件互连)设备,由于该技术是基于硬件实现的,可以使虚拟机获得与宿主机相似的I/O性能。在OpenStack云平台中,一台物理服务器上可能同时运行着十几台虚拟机,这对于物理服务器的I/O性能要求是非常高的。因此,I/O虚拟化技术的效率对于整个OpenStack云平台的网络性能提升都有着至关重要的作用。为了提高系统整体的网络性能,在OpenStack云平台中引入SR-IOV技术成为一种可选的方式。本论文选取OpenStack开

6、源云平台与SR-IOV技术作为研究课题,探索了SR-IOV技术在OpenStack云平台中的应用,主要内容可归纳如下:(1)研究了OpenStack云平台的架构,以及网络服务组件Neutron的原理。着重分析了Neutron组件在Vlan网络环境下的网络拓扑结构,并指出了OpenStack云平台中网络I/O性能的瓶颈所在;(2)研究了I/O虚拟化技术的几种常见方式,分析了SR-IOV技术的基本原理。提出OpenStack云平台与SR-IOV技术相结合的观点。同时,详细分析了OpenStack云平台在有无SR-IOV技术这

7、两种情况下,虚拟机进行数据通信的流量路径;(3)研究了SR-IOV技术在OpenStack云平台上的应用,并搭建了三节点的武汉邮电科学研究院硕士学位论文OpenStack环境用于测试实验。测试环境使用一台物理服务器作为OpenStack云平台的控制节点及网络节点,另外两台物理服务器则作为OpenStack云平台的计算节点。修改OpenStack云平台的部分配置文件,将SR-IOV技术运用到云平台中。通过对比实验测试SR-IOV技术对于OpenStack云平台上网络I/O性能的影响。最终对实验结果进行分析可知,在引入SR-

8、IOV技术后,OpenStack云平台中的计算节点I/O虚拟化性能提升了约50%。关键词:虚拟化;SR-IOV技术;I/O性能;云计算;OpenStack云平台武汉邮电科学研究院硕士学位论文AbstractWiththearrivalofthecloudera,avarietyofcloudcomputingplat

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。